Feb 14

Batasan dan Jenis-jenis Perintah SQL Server 2000

Batasan SQL Server 2000

Microsoft SQL Server mempunyai beberapa batasan dimana batasan tersebut memilikiĀ  prioritas diatas trigger, aturan dan nilai defaultnya. Sebagai gambaran table berikut akan menjelaskan batasan-batasan yang dimaksud.

Fungsi Keterangan
NOT NULL Menentukan bahwa kolom tidak bias menentukan nilai NULL
CHECH Membatasi nilai yang bias diletakkan kedalan kolom dengan menentukan suatu kondisi. Misalnya nilai TRUE maka nilai yang diberikan dapat dimasukkan kedalam kolom sedang apabila FLASE
UNIQUE Memasukkan kolom-kolom memiliki nilai eksklusif
PRYMARY KEY Membuat kata kunci primer atau kunci utama dari sebuah table, kolom atau kombinasi dari kolom dengan nilai yang harus bersifat eksekutif didalam table untuk mengenali baris
FOREIGN KEY Menentukan hubungan antara table-tabel

Continue reading

Feb 14

Microsoft SQL Server 2000

SQL Server 2000

Microsoft SQL Server merupakan produk RDBMS (Relational Database Management System) yang dibuat oleh Microsoft. Orang sering menyebutnya dengan SQL Server saja. Microsoft SQL Server juga mendukung SQL sebagai bahasa untuk memproses query ke dalam database. Microsoft SQL Server Mirosoft SQL Server banyak digunakan pada dunia bisnis, pendidikan atau juga pemerintahan sebagai solusi database atau penyimpanan data. Pada tahun 2000 Microsoft mengeluarkan SQL Server 2000 yang merupakan versi yang banyak digunakan. Berikut ini adalah beberapa fitur yang dari sekian banyak fitur yang ada pada SQL Server 2000 [Rado05]:

  1. XML Support. Dengan fitur ini, Anda bisa menyimpan dokumen XML dalam suatu tabel, meng-query data ke dalam format XML melalui Transact-SQL dan lain sebagainya.
  2. Multi-Instance Support. Fitur ini memungkinkan Anda untuk menjalankan beberapa database engine SQL Server pada mesin yang sama.
  3. Data Warehousing and Business Intelligence (BI) Improvements. SQL Server dilengkapi dengan fungsi-fungsi untuk keperluan Business Intelligence melalui Analysis Services. Selain itu, SQL Server 2000 juga ditambahi dengan tools untuk keperluan data mining.
  4. Performance and Scalability Improvements. SQL Server menerapkan distributed partitioned views yang memungkinkan untuk membagi workload ke beberapa server sekaligus. Peningkatan lainnya juga dicapai di sisi DBCC, indexed view, dan index reorganization.
  5. Query Analyzer Improvements. Fitur yang dihadirkan antara lain: integrated debugger, object browser, dan fasilitas object search.
  6. DTS Enhancement. Fasilitas ini sekarang sudah mampu untuk memperhatikan primary key danĀ  foreign key constraints. Ini berguna pada saat migrasi tabel dari RDBMS lain.
  7. Transact-SQL Enhancements. Salah satu peningkatan disini adalah T-SQL sudah mendukung UDF (User-Definable Function). Ini memungkinkan Anda untuk menyimpan rutin-rutin ke dalam database enginen. Continue reading
Dec 14

SQL Server

Microsoft SQL Server

Microsoft SQL Server adalah sebuah sistem manajemen basis data relasional (RDBMS) produk Microsoft. Bahasa kueri utamanya adalah Transact-SQL yang merupakan implementasi dari SQL standar ANSI/ISO yang digunakan oleh Microsoft dan Sybase. Umumnya SQL Server digunakan di dunia bisnis yang memiliki basis data berskala kecil sampai dengan menengah, tetapi kemudian berkembang dengan digunakannya SQL Server pada basis data besar.